  12.   In physics, you can determine how much force with which an object is sliding down a frictionless incline by adding the gravitational force vector and the ''normal force'' vector. The normal force vector is always directed up out of the incline perpendicular to it (90° more than the measure of the incline). The magnitude m of the normal force can be calculated by m = f cos , where f is the gravitational force and is the angle measure of the incline.
